Publications update

Several publications have emerged from the group. The analysis of the inclusion of spacelike constraints and phase of timelike data with the observable Pi'(-Q^2) has resulted in a publication authored by Gauhar Abbas, B. Ananthanarayan and S. Ramanan. Soon afterwards the study of the pi K scalar form factor was taken up, and the inclusion of constraints from the well-known Callan-Treiman point, and now from the soft Kaon analog of the point, now christened the second Callan-Treiman point was taken up. It has been shown that based on such analyticity techniques one can now estimate the correction at the second point to the one-loop result which amounts to about 3%. The resulting publication by Gauhar Abbas and B. Ananthanarayan reports these findings.

Report prepared by Gauhar

Anant gave an orientation talk for Strong Frontier 2009 workshop. He explained various things,e.g. chiral symmetry breaking, chiral perturbation theory,string theory and nonpertubative methods in QCD etc. He spoke of the importance of these issues in testing QCD as an appropriate theory of strong interactions. He also dicussed Heavy Quark Symmetry and Heavy Quark Effective Theory which have quite importance in Heavy flavour Physics.
